>  기사  >  백엔드 개발  >  php5isapi.dll이 없는 경우 수행할 작업

php5isapi.dll이 없는 경우 수행할 작업

藏色散人
藏色散人원래의
2020-08-13 10:05:241873검색

PHP5.3.1" 버전부터 PHP가 더 이상 ISAPI 모드를 지원하지 않기 때문에 "php5isapi.dll"이 없습니다. 따라서 "php5isapi.dll" 파일은 PHP 버전 "5.3.1" 이상의 php 디렉토리에서 볼 수 없습니다. . , 해결책은 더 높은 구성의 버전을 설치하는 것입니다.

php5isapi.dll이 없는 경우 수행할 작업

추천: "PHP 비디오 튜토리얼"

구체적인 질문:

일부 PHP 설치 패키지에 php5isapi.dll이 없는 이유는 무엇입니까? 요구사항: IIS6에 최신 버전의 PHP를 설치하고 싶습니다. 5.6.4

공식 웹사이트에서 최신 버전의 PHP를 다운로드하세요. 왜 php5isapi.dll DLL이 없나요?

답변:

PHP 버전 5.3.1부터 PHP는 더 이상 ISAPI 모드를 지원하지 않으므로 PHP 버전 5.3.1 이상의 php 디렉토리에서 php5isapi.dll 파일을 볼 수 없습니다.

따라서 IIS6에서 PHP 5.3.1 이상을 실행하는 경우 더 이상 ISAPI 모드를 사용하여 PHP를 실행할 수 없지만 고급 FastCGI 모드를 사용할 수 있습니다.

IIS6 자체는 FastCGI를 통합하지 않으므로 상위 버전을 실행하려면 iis.net 사이트로 이동하여 FastCGI를 다운로드, 설치 및 구성해야 합니다.

또한 IIS6은 win7 이하 시스템에서 사용할 수 있어야 하기 때문에 PHP5.6.4와 같은 상위 버전을 실행할 수 없습니다. 따라서 PHP5.4부터는 더 이상 win7(NT6.0) Windows 운영 체제 이하 시스템을 지원하지 않습니다. 따라서 IIS6에서 지원하는 가장 큰 PHP 버전은 PHP5.4 시리즈입니다.

즉, IIS6+FastCGI+PHP5.4

위 내용은 php5isapi.dll이 없는 경우 수행할 작업의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.